
Sfoglini crafts innovative pastas using organic American semolina and local farm ingredients, slow-dried for flavor preservation.
Founded with a mission to blend traditional pasta-making techniques with modern culinary innovation, Sfoglini sources organic American semolina flour and unique ingredients from local farms to create high-quality pastas. Their products are crafted using traditional bronze dies for a rough texture that enhances sauce adherence and are slow-dried at low temperatures to preserve flavor and nutrients. Sfoglini's market focus includes health-conscious consumers and gourmet food enthusiasts looking for artisanal pasta options.
Notable figures affiliated with Sfoglini include its founders, who have backgrounds in culinary arts and sustainable food production. The company has garnered attention from food critics and has been featured in various culinary publications. Key achievements include expanding their product line to include limited editions and collaborations, as well as establishing a Pasta Club subscription service. Sfoglini has made a significant impact by promoting sustainable agriculture and elevating the quality of American-made pasta.

Sfoglini was founded in 2012.
Sfoglini's headquarters is located in West Coxsackie, NY, US.
Sfoglini's most recent funding round was for $1.5M (USD) in September 2018.
As of Sep 5, 2018, Sfoglini has raised a total of $4M (USD).
Sfoglini has 5 employees as of Feb 4, 2024.
